Briana is deeply passionate and dedicated to working with youth and improving community outcomes. She firmly believes that when adults invest in young people, they, in turn, contribute positively back to our society. The licensed clinical social worker is motivated each day to support children in pursuing their expressed interests and achieving their personal goals. After witnessing the speed as well as observing the challenges students experienced within the legal system, the Baton Rouge resident felt like she was led to LCCR and its advocacy because “many children and families lack the necessary knowledge and resources to navigate the complexities of the justice system.” Due to the organization’s efforts, she is able have a direct impact on the lives of the youth she serves and help change their future. Briana received her Bachelor’s in Sociology and Master’s in Social Work from Louisiana State University.
